yep i sure do ive been drawing and painiting flames for many years. though my pin striping needs work. and about how i did the weathering its all done with acarlic paint and some shades of browns i made by mixing them up. i brush it all on and them i use a old crusty dry rag and rub the paint around. then i repeat it again and so on. its pretty easy to do.
